SCOPE

16th International Conference on Digital Image Processing and Pattern Recognition (DPPR 2026) is a forum for presenting new advances and research results in the fields of Digital Image Processing. The Conference will bring together leading researchers, engineers and scientists in the domain of interest from around the world. The scope of the conference covers all theoretical and practical aspects of the Digital Image Processing & Pattern Recognition, from basic research to development of application.


Authors are solicited to contribute to the Conference by submitting articles that illustrate research results, projects, surveying works and industrial experiences that describe significant advances in the following areas, but are not limited to.

Paper Submission

Authors are invited to submit papers through the conference Submission System by August 22, 2026. Submissions must be original and should not have been published previously or be under consideration for publication while being evaluated for this conference. The proceedings of the conference will be published by Computer Science Conference Proceedings in Computer Science & Information Technology (CS & IT) series (Confirmed).


Selected papers from DPPR 2026, after further revisions, will be published in the special issue of the following journal.

  • Signal & Image Processing : An International Journal (SIPIJ)
  • International Journal of VLSI design & Communication Systems (VLSICS)
  • Information Technology in Industry (ITII)
